What is a computer science intern?

A Computer Science Intern is a temporary position where students or recent graduates gain hands-on experience in software development, data analysis, cybersecurity, or other computing fields. Interns typically assist with coding, debugging, research, and testing while working under the guidance of experienced professionals. This role helps build technical skills, industry knowledge, and networking opportunities, preparing interns for full-time positions in the tech industry.

What kind of projects and tasks can I expect as a computer science intern?

As a Computer Science Intern, you can expect to work on a variety of tasks such as writing and testing code, debugging software, supporting ongoing development projects, and collaborating on team-based assignments. Interns often contribute to designing features, fixing bugs, conducting research, or assisting in quality assurance under the guidance of senior engineers or mentors. The exact nature of your projects may vary based on the company and team, but you will typically gain hands-on experience with real-world software development tools and workflows. This exposure not only builds your technical skills but also helps you understand agile work environments and best practices, making it a valuable step toward a full-time role in the field.

CNA is hiring for an IT Service Desk Intern. The IT Service Desk Internship at CNA offers a unique opportunity for individuals with a blend of technical acumen and writing skills to contribute to the efficiency of our IT operations. This intern will be responsible for providing first-level support to internal users, addressing technical queries, and troubleshooting issues. This role is ideal for those looking to apply their knowledge in a practical setting while gaining experience in drafting and refining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for IT service delivery.
